Frequently asked questions about holiday rentals in Madagascar

  • What are the must-see places in Madagascar?

    Madagascar boasts incredible diversity. For natural beauty, you absolutely must see the Avenue of the Baobabs near Morondava, Isalo National Park with its dramatic sandstone formations, and the Tsingy de Bemaraha Strict Nature Reserve, a UNESCO World Heritage site with its unique karst landscape. For wildlife, consider a visit to the Masoala National Park in the northeast, known for its incredible biodiversity, or the Anja Community Reserve, home to ring-tailed lemurs.

  • What are the typical activities to do in Madagascar?

    Activities are as varied as the landscape. Hiking and trekking are popular, particularly in Isalo National Park and the Tsingy. Wildlife spotting, especially lemurs, is a major draw, often involving guided nature walks or treks. Boat trips to see whales (seasonal) and other marine life are also popular, particularly off the coast of Nosy Be. For a more relaxed experience, you might enjoy exploring the beaches of Nosy Iranja or Ile Sainte Marie.

  • Which part of Madagascar offers the most pleasant climate?

    The highlands, particularly around Antananarivo, offer a generally pleasant climate, with cooler temperatures than the coastal regions. However, even the highlands experience distinct wet and dry seasons. The coastal areas are generally hotter and more humid.

  • What airport options are there for reaching Madagascar?

    The main international airport is Antananarivo Ivato International Airport (TNR). This is where most international flights arrive. There are also smaller airports in other regions, such as Nosy Be, but these primarily serve domestic and regional flights.

  • Are there specific challenges to driving in Madagascar that visitors should know?

    Driving in Madagascar can be challenging. Road conditions vary enormously, from well-maintained roads around major cities to very rough and poorly maintained tracks in more remote areas. 4x4 vehicles are often recommended for venturing outside of urban areas. Driving at night can be particularly hazardous due to poor lighting and the presence of pedestrians and animals on the roads. It's advisable to hire a driver familiar with local conditions.

  • What currency is used in Madagascar?

    The Malagasy Ariary (MGA) is the official currency.
  • What are the top festivals to experience in Madagascar?

    The Famadihana, or 'turning of the bones', is a unique and significant cultural event where families exhume and rebury their ancestors. It's a vibrant and colourful celebration, though the timing varies by family and region. The Donia Festival, celebrating the arrival of the new rice harvest, is another important event, typically taking place in the highlands. Specific dates vary annually.
  • What is the best time of year to visit Madagascar?

    The best time to visit generally depends on the region and what you want to do. The dry season (April to October) is generally best for most activities, offering clearer skies and better conditions for hiking and wildlife viewing. However, the wet season (November to March) can be a good time to visit if you don't mind rain and want to see the landscape lush and green.
  • What are some local dishes to try in Madagascar?

    Romazava, a hearty beef stew with vegetables, is a national favourite. Try also henakisoa, a chicken dish cooked in a coconut milk sauce, and ravitoto, a dish of braised greens with meat. For something different, sample various types of local fruits and seafood.

  • What etiquette tips are important when visiting Madagascar?

    It is polite to greet people with a handshake, and always show respect to elders. Bargaining is common in markets, but do so politely. Dress modestly, especially when visiting religious sites. Learning a few basic Malagasy phrases is always appreciated.
  • What are the best areas to spend a week in Madagascar?

    A week allows for a good exploration of one or two regions. Consider a week exploring the highlands, including Antananarivo and the surrounding area, or focusing on the west coast, combining the Avenue of the Baobabs with a visit to Isalo National Park. Nosy Be and its surrounding islands are also a great option for a week-long beach and island-hopping holiday.
  • What are the best areas to spend a weekend in Madagascar?

    For a weekend, Antananarivo itself offers a good base for exploring the city and its surrounding areas. Alternatively, if you prefer a more relaxed getaway, a weekend in Nosy Be or Ile Sainte Marie would be ideal, focusing on beaches and watersports.
  • What are the top shopping destinations in Madagascar?

    The Zoma Market in Antananarivo is a large and vibrant market offering a wide range of goods, from handicrafts to clothing and food. Smaller markets exist in most towns and cities, offering a more local shopping experience. You can also find souvenirs and handicrafts in many tourist areas.
  • What are some off-the-beaten-path places to explore in Madagascar?

    The far north of Madagascar, including the region around Diego Suarez, offers stunning landscapes and a more remote experience. The Makay Massif, a vast and unexplored region in the southwest, is ideal for adventurous travellers seeking a true off-the-beaten-path experience, but requires careful planning and preparation.
